The basic principle of the COMAND operating, display and control unit (A40/3) is central control of the different comfort components (radio tuner, telephone, navigation etc.) and simplifying operation. A multistandard CD drive is integrated in the COMAND operating, display and control unit (A40/3) that is designed for navigation digital versatile disks (DVDs) and audio CDs. A TV tuner is also integrated in the COMAND operating, display and control unit (A40/3). Some of the COMAND operating, display and control unit (A40/3) controls have specific functions, i.e. the function that is activated is independent of the currently selected menu.
All of the components that can be controlled by the COMAND operating, display and control unit (A40/3) are networked together by the Digital Data Bus (D2B). This networking allows the components to be installed in different places in the vehicle without affecting operation using the COMAND operating, display and control unit (A40/3).
The system configuration is described in the following. The following are integrated in the COMAND operating, display and control unit (A40/3):
- Navigation processor
- Multistandard CD drive
- TV tuner with multifunction capability
The COMAND operating, display and control unit (A40/3) is equipped with an external "AUX" connection for a cassette player (CC) or minidisk player (MD).
There is a cursor key (combined with an Enter key) on the left-hand side beneath the display for navigation purposes. It is used for navigating around the map, (manually) entering destinations on the map and searching within a navigation list.
With code (347a) EMERGENCY CALL (D2B) emergency call system the E-call control unit (A35/8) is installed in the vehicle. The following components are integrated in this unit:
- Yaw rate sensor
- Global Positioning System (GPS) receiver
- Rollover sensor
The following external components and system can be operated using the COMAND operating, display and control unit (A40/3):
- With code (819a) CD changer
- With code (813) Voice control system (VCS)
- Telephone system
Voice output
The COMAND operating, display and control unit (A40/3) has 2 voice output options:
- Japanese
- English
